“She said she’d jump” – PDRM Says Woman Who Died on KESAS Highway Wasn’t Thrown From Van

In an update by PDRM on the case of the 44-year-old woman who fell from a van on KESAS Highway, the police said the victim jumped out of the moving vehicle.

KL Police Chief, Datuk Rusdi Mohd Isa, said the suspect, who was also the husband of the victim, revealed the matter during an interrogation and added that he was arguing with his wife before the jump took place.

Datuk Rusdi said the married couple was arguing about how the woman would occasionally drive the van despite having no driver’s license.

“During the argument, the victim told her husband that she was going to jump out of the vehicle before doing so.”

“Her 50-year-old husband continued the journey home, where he was arrested on the same day,” Datuk Rusdi explained during a press conference at IPK KL today.

Untitled Design 2 1024X683 1

According to the police, the suspect will be remanded until May 10 to assist in the investigation, which is launched under Section 304(A) of the Penal Code for causing death by negligence.

Earlier, the victim was spotted falling out of a van on KESAS Highway near the Awan Besar R&R. A witness then stopped to check on her and called the ambulance, but the victim passed away before she could receive medical help.
